Output c3d44a200e15ad8100d23bbc1b85382e1e6755e9c723c91b7d59bf5eeaea8019:7

value
31685003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d5b17718823375fa2fe0f3d9fd15bc52973ff9 OP_EQUAL
address
MU2ptJFtffGbRuMKbW2mcAnfGH8id8UVds
transaction
c3d44a200e15ad8100d23bbc1b85382e1e6755e9c723c91b7d59bf5eeaea8019
spent
true